Tybee Island Wine Festival to benefit theater
Placeholder Image

The Tybee Island Wine Festival will be held Saturday from 2-5 p.m. on the grounds of the Tybee Island Light Station.

The event will benefit the restoration of the Tybee Post Theater.

There will be more than 100 wines from around the world available for tasting and purchase.
The cost for tickets is $45, which includes small bites and tapas dishes from local eateries and caterers, soft drinks and a tote bag with souvenir wine glass.

There will be live music and entertainment, raffles and auctions throughout the afternoon.

Shuttles to the theater will take attendees to see the latest progress.

Bring blankets and chairs to enjoy the afternoon at the foot of Georgia’s oldest lighthouse.

The rain location is the Tybee cafeteria and gym.

The event is sponsored by the City of Tybee Island, Tybee Island Historical Society and the Friends of the Tybee Theater.
